This place has just been renovated. In my opinion, probably the most popular dancing/bar place in the area. On weekends it may get very busy that there is a line-up outside. It is located in the middle of the village not far from the Westin...Hotel. In the basement there is another bar which is used if the bar upstairs is almost at full capacity. There is also a few nice terraces around the building to go outside to get some fresh air if need be.More
